[Profile]
Born in Soria, Spain in 1952. In 1966, he became an apprentice at the Jose Ramirez III workshop, where he spent the golden years of Ramirez's career with Mariano Tezanos Martin (1915-1982) and Paulino Bernabé (1932-2007). After becoming independent from the Ramirez workshop, he began collaborating with Mariano Tesanos (1949- the son of Tezanos Martin), a colleague from the same workshop. Since 2005, he and his son Sergio have been making guitars under their own label, Teodoro Perez.
This brand is popular in Japan for its profound and gorgeous tone, luxurious construction, and powerful sound, which is typical of the Madrid school, which is descended from the Ramirez line. The Flamenco model is also famous for being used by guitarist Jin Oki.
